Output 95399861b1a2eb0b58980a222a93695a26f337a2a60e43e71a7c21161a08ea3e:1

value
2474192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fc35290c599872fcee279c0c3edb43dca379e4 OP_EQUAL
address
36Lbqq8B7yvhSrv4r4XFFHvbopDx2gjsR2
transaction
95399861b1a2eb0b58980a222a93695a26f337a2a60e43e71a7c21161a08ea3e
spent
true